'''Benny Hill's Madcap Chase''' is an [[adventure]] game, which had been released by [[DK'Tronics]] for the [[Sinclair ZX Spectrum]] in [[1985]]; as its name implies, it stars a caricature of the comedian of the same name (1924-1992), and is based upon his Thames Television series (which ran from [[1974]] to [[1989]]).
